Mapping single-cell-resolution cell phylogeny reveals cell population dynamics during organ development.
Nature methods - 1 Dec 2021
Liu Kehui, Deng Shanjun, Ye Chang, Yao Zeqi, Wang Jianguo, Gong Han, Liu Li, He Xionglei
Abstract excerpt
Mapping the cell phylogeny of a complex multicellular organism relies on somatic mutations accumulated from zygote to adult. Available cell barcoding methods can record about three mutations per barcode, enabling only low-resolution mapping of the cell phylogeny of complex organisms. Here we developed SMALT, a substitution mutation-aided lineage-tracing system that outperforms the available cell barcoding methods...
